Quality Assurance Professionals Share Their Insight
Throughout its 76-year history, AABB has remained committed to advancing quality and safety for the blood and biotherapies field and promoting a regulatory environment that drives progress and supports blood availability and safety. Quality assurance is an integral component of blood banking and a mandatory requirement to ensure safe and effective blood transfusion services. Quality assurance professionals play a critical role in assessing each step of the transfusion process, from performing audits and monitoring quality measures, to incident reporting and ensuring all areas of the blood bank are operating in compliance with AABB standards and applicable government regulations. The following AABB institutional members share their insight as quality professionals, including strategies to help facilities maximize quality assurance efficiency while navigating challenges and turbulent times.

Quality assurance plays a vital role in ensuring the delivery of reliable and high-quality products or services. However, in the fast-paced world of blood and biotherapies, optimizing quality assurance processes and maximizing efficiency is crucial. This is where the 80/20 rule, also known as the Pareto Principle, comes into play. In this article, we will explore the 80/20 rule and how it can be applied to quality assurance, enabling organizations to focus their efforts on the most impactful areas and achieve better results. The 80/20 rule, originally coined by Italian economist Vilfredo Pareto, states that roughly 80% of the effects come from 20% of the causes. This principle has found applications in various fields, highlighting the imbalanced distribution of inputs and outputs. In quality assurance, the rule suggests that a significant majority of issues or defects can be traced back to a small subset of causes or components. By identifying and addressing these critical areas, blood facilities can make significant improvements in the overall quality of their products or services. Here are four ways to apply the 80/20 rule to quality assurance:
1. Identifying critical equipment, supplies and processes: The first step in applying the 80/20 rule to quality assurance is identifying the key components or factors that have the most significant impact on the quality of blood and biotherapy products. By conducting a thorough analysis and gathering data, quality assurance teams can pinpoint the critical areas that require the most attention and resources.
2. Prioritizing efforts: Once the critical items and processes are identified, it is essential to prioritize efforts accordingly. The 80/20 rule suggests that allocating resources, time and attention to the vital few areas will yield the most significant improvements. This prioritization ensures that the most critical issues are addressed first, maximizing the impact of quality assurance efforts.
3. Focusing on root causes: By applying the 80/20 rule, quality assurance teams can concentrate their efforts on addressing the root causes of quality issues. Instead of chasing after every minor issue, the rule encourages a deeper analysis to identify the underlying factors that contribute to the majority of problems. By resolving these root causes, blood and biotherapy organizations can prevent a significant portion of quality deviations from occurring in the first place.
4. Continuous improvement: The 80/20 rule encourages a culture of continuous improvement in quality assurance. By regularly analyzing data, reviewing results and trends and adjusting strategies, organizations can adapt to changing regulatory requirements and emerging challenges. This iterative approach allows quality assurance teams to constantly refine their processes and concentrate on the areas that have the most significant impact on blood and biotherapy product quality.
The 80/20 rule offers a valuable framework for optimizing quality assurance efforts. By identifying the vital few items and processes, prioritizing efforts and focusing on root causes, organizations can achieve higher quality standards while efficiently allocating resources. Applying the rule enables quality assurance teams to concentrate on the areas that have the most significant impact, maximizing effectiveness and ensuring safe, pure and potent blood and biotherapy products. Embracing a culture of continuous improvement further enhances the application of the 80/20 rule, allowing organizations to adapt and excel in an ever-changing environment. By leveraging this principle, blood and biotherapy organizations can strengthen their quality assurance practices and deliver products and services that consistently meet and exceed internal and external customer and regulatory expectations.
The 80/20 Rule: Focusing Our Efforts

Are you at times good at doing things that do not need to be done (at all)?
The 80/20 principle is one of the greatest secrets of highly effective people and organizations, and we can utilize the 80/20 rule to increase quality assurance efficiency. As quality professionals, we naturally gravitate to the premise that everything is a priority and spend many hours being reactive versus proactive. We can be more effective and proactive with less effort by learning how to identify and leverage the 80/20 principle: that 80% of all our results in business and in life stem from a mere 20% of our efforts.
The simplest approach is to create a risk framework within your department and apply quality tools available. Workload planning and management is critical. Data supports that 20% of our time accounts for 80% of the work we accomplish. The 80/20 principle shows how we can achieve much more with much less effort, time and resources, simply by identifying and focusing our efforts on the 20% that really counts. For example, integration of the quality management systems for workflow, power of automation and returning defective supply demonstrate that if you apply the principle in a systematic and practical way, you can vastly increase your effectiveness, and improve your value to your organization. The unspoken corollary to the 80/20 principle is that little of what we spend our time on counts. But by concentrating on those things that do, we can unlock the enormous potential of the magic 20%, and transform our effectiveness in our jobs, careers, businesses and lives.
Navigating Turbulent Times

All organizations face uncertainty with adequate staffing due to external or internal forces. Often the quality activities are prioritized lower than other more direct operational needs. When faced with the issue of not enough staff to do all that is required for the planned quality activities, applying quality principles such as risk assessment and mitigation to the staffing (quality unit and operational divisions) issue can be a valuable approach. This activity need not be as robust as the action needed to introduce a new process or policy around actual manufacturing or testing, but it may be helpful identifying the quality assurance tasks that are most likely to mitigate problems or issues. It can then become an evaluated prioritization plan.
For example, error management could become the top priority for staff attention as an effective approach to preventing a repeat of errors that create a threat to the quality of products or services and lead to a lot of time-consuming work. A focus on change control for ideas that may come from finding forced efficiencies may also become a priority. Careful planning and a strong transition plan can head off unexpected and time-consuming efforts to correct unintended outcomes. These activities could be prioritized over other quality functions, such as auditing, validation or verification planning for new equipment or processes that may be placed on hold until more operational and quality staff are available. Use your quality assurance tool kit, apply it to your quality plan and activities and let prioritization from a risk assessment perspective help you navigate these turbulent times.
The Importance of Quality Assurance: Five Crucial Processes

When it comes to cord blood banking, the role of quality assurance is of paramount importance as it encompasses several key processes and tasks that ensure the highest standards of safety and quality. Quality assurance in cord blood banking involves the implementation of various specific jobs and procedures that contribute to the overall quality management system. Here are five crucial processes that underscore the significance of quality assurance:
1. Development of quality indicators: Quality assurance specialists in cord blood banking establish and monitor quality indicators that serve as measurable parameters to assess the quality of cord blood units. These indicators can include factors like cell viability, sterility and potency, among others. By continuously tracking these indicators, quality assurance ensures that cord blood units meet predefined quality standards.
2. Internal audits: Quality assurance professionals conduct regular internal audits to assess compliance with standard operating procedures (SOPs), regulatory requirements and industry best practices. These audits help identify areas for improvement, address any deviations and ensure that cord blood banking processes are consistent, efficient and in line with established protocols.
3. Documentation and recordkeeping: Quality assurance plays a crucial role in maintaining accurate and comprehensive documentation and recordkeeping practices. This includes tracking and recording all aspects of cord blood collection, processing, storage and distribution. Robust documentation ensures traceability, allows for retrospective analysis and supports transparency and accountability.
4. Risk management: Quality assurance specialists are responsible for implementing risk management strategies in cord blood banking. They identify potential risks and develop mitigation plans to minimize their impact. This proactive approach helps ensure the safety and quality of cord blood units throughout the entire process, from collection to transplantation.
5. Validation and verification: Quality assurance professionals validate and verify all critical processes, equipment and methodologies used in cord blood banking. This includes validating storage systems, testing procedures and equipment functionality. By conducting rigorous validations, quality assurance ensures that all components of the cord blood banking workflow are reliable and accurate.
These are just a few examples of the specific jobs and processes within quality assurance that highlight its crucial role in cord blood banking. By maintaining quality indicators, conducting internal audits, ensuring meticulous documentation, managing risks and validating procedures, quality assurance professionals uphold the highest standards in cord blood banking.
